Abstract

The automatic hot food dispenser has adjustable height storage columns (65) for food products. The storage is in the upper part of the dispenser. The middle part of the dispenser has chutes (68) delivering food from the base of the stack to the inlet hatch of a microwave oven (90, 91). Each microwave oven has an ejector system that places the heated food on a conveyor (71) for delivery to the consumer. A cutlery ejector delivers cutlery. The lower part of the dispenser houses a vending unit.

FR-A-2.597.239: "The invention relates to a set of distribution of cooked dishes, stored at low temperature, under vacuum, sterilized or other, and served hot in a fully automated manner. It is composed of a part electronic programmable by its keyboard which is the brain of the distributor, a refrigerated storage compartment for cooked meals, an automatic conveying device for meals in a group of microwave ovens for reheating a refrigeration unit of a cold box. The assembly according to the invention is particularly intended for the automatic distribution of hot cooked dishes. This device clearly defines the state of the art. It has the main disadvantage of making available to the public a microwave oven battery. Microwave ovens must meet very stringent safety conditions, but making microwave ovens available to the public is problematic Thus, these ovens may be subject to acts of vandalism or improper use.
